The concept of the Index of Downfall is rooted in the work of historians and scholars who have studied the rise and fall of empires throughout history. One of the earliest and most influential works on the subject is Edward Gibbon's "The History of the Decline and Fall of the Roman Empire," which identified a range of factors that contributed to the decline of the Roman Empire, including corruption, decadence, and external pressures.

The first indicator of a pending downfall is the systematic removal of personal accountability. When an organization or society reaches this stage, mistakes are not treated as learning opportunities, but as threats to be covered up.

When an entity spends wealth it hasn't yet earned, it enters a state of "terminal debt." In ancient Rome, this took the form of debasing the currency to pay for a bloated military.
